Red flags
2 immediate-jeopardy citations in the most recent inspection cycle
Immediate jeopardy is the most serious finding an inspector can make: a situation likely to cause serious injury, harm, or death.
RN staffing in the bottom 10% nationally
0.17 registered-nurse hours per resident per day, vs a 0.58 national median and 0.75 benchmark.
66% of nursing staff left within a year
High turnover disrupts continuity of care; the national median is 45%.
